Output 676fba307b77928b251fd1d4f54e273659415a40d109fc4133172adc6627e6b8:0

value
18700
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1758a9831d04187e11ab5bf4fdbbb51a113c4251 OP_EQUALVERIFY OP_CHECKSIG
address
138SkmUNguBgkAtdcqXV1xdwNomog4a4bp
transaction
676fba307b77928b251fd1d4f54e273659415a40d109fc4133172adc6627e6b8
spent
true